  • Publication number: 20200211774
    Abstract: An electronic component includes an element body and an external electrode disposed on the element body. The external electrode includes a sintered metal layer, a conductive resin layer disposed on the sintered metal layer, and a solder plating layer arranged to constitute an outermost layer of the external electrode. A space exists in the conductive resin layer or between the conductive resin layer and the sintered metal layer. A first maximum length of the space in a thickness direction of the conductive resin layer is shorter than a second maximum length of the space in a direction orthogonal to the thickness direction of the conductive resin layer.

  • Publication number: 20200211775
    Abstract: An electronic component includes an element body and an external electrode disposed on the element body. The external electrode includes a conductive resin layer, a solder plating layer arranged to constitute an outermost layer of the external electrode, and an intermediate plating layer disposed between the conductive resin layer and the solder plating layer. The intermediate plating layer has better solder leach resistance than metal contained in the conductive resin layer. An opening is formed in the intermediate plating layer. The solder plating layer is formed on the conductive resin layer through the opening.

  • Patent number: 10495131
    Abstract: A blind nut assembly including a bush and nut. The bush includes a short cylindrical collar, which has a polygonal outer surface on the outer surface thereof, and a flange, the outer surface of which is polygonal. The nut consists of a female screw member, on which a female screw to be mated with a male screw on a bolt is formed; and a nut cylindrical member, which is formed adjacent to the female screw member, which has a polygonal inner surface on the inner surface thereof aligning with the polygonal outer surface of the collar, of which the outer surface is also a polygonal outer surface, and which has a wall thickness that is thinner than the female screw member. The nut head has an outer diameter which is larger than the maximum outer diameter of the nut cylindrical member, is formed above the nut cylindrical member.

  • Patent number: 10032559
    Abstract: An electronic component is provided with an element body and terminal electrodes. The terminal electrodes include sintered metal layers and conductive resin layers. A first length, which is a length of the sintered metal layers in a first direction at end portions of a side surface in a second direction, is shorter than a second length, which is a length of the sintered metal layers in the first direction at central portions of the side surface in the second direction. A third length, which is a length of the conductive resin layers in the first direction at the end portions, is shorter than a fourth length, which is a length of the conductive resin layers in the first direction at the central portions. A difference between the fourth length and the third length is larger than a difference between the second length and the first length.

  • Patent number: 9759152
    Abstract: A fuel injection control apparatus of a four cycle engine having three cylinders comprises: a crank angle detection device for detecting the crank angle of the four cycle engine; a first computation device for computing the quantity of fuel, which is injected in a predetermined stroke of a four stroke cycle, at a first computation timing; a second computation device for computing the quantity of fuel, which is injected one stroke before the predetermined stroke, at a second computation timing 240 degrees ahead of the crank angle of the first computation timing; and a third computation device for computing the quantity of fuel, which is injected two strokes before the predetermined stroke, at a third computation timing 240 degrees ahead of the crank angle of the second computation timing. The fuel injection control apparatus is adapted to decrease interruptions by computations for fuel injection control in the three cylinder engine, and reduce control load.
